Is Karvol In Steam Advisable For Blocked Nose?

default
Posted on Tue, 21 Feb 2017
Question: My nostrils are blocked I had taken nosikind for 4 days and I now know that I am pregnant. I stopped using it but I have trouble breathing. Can I use karvol in steam .? Please help it's XXXXXXX and dis month I did not get periods my date is 22. I was given antibiotics on 28 December for 5 days will it effect my child? I am worried please give solution for blocked nostrils. I cannot sleep at nights.

Now about your problem.Nosikind nasal drops are decongestant drops ..& being local not likely to affect pregnancy (provided you take it not more than three times) . Your idea of inhaling vapors of Karvol capseals is also nonrisky..You have to inhale the vapor twice a day (12 hrly ).. not when atmosperic temperature is high (so early morning &night are the ideal times yo have it)
If you have head ache.. you can take Tab.paracetamol twice after food.Take rest.avoid known allergens/dust,fumes/exposure to cold weather/sour , oily or cold etables or drinks/drink lot of warm water&have light nourishing food.
Normally symptoms should subcide in 4-days. If they don't visit your gynic doctor for addition of specific drugs for early relief.
The short (5days) course of antibiotics you had... is not likely to affect.. still show the prescription to your gynecologist... for necessary precautions.
